Bug Description

Binary package hint: gwibber

I have been seeing the gwibber-service process use 90-100% CPU after running for a while.

The symptoms I have witnessed seem the same as bug #554005, but this is reported as fixed in a previous release of gwibber.

In short:

Gwibber starts normally with login.
After some time (never put a stopwatch on it, TBH, but a few minutes at least) gwibber starts using 90-100% of one CPU core. This continues until the process is killed. Res-starting gwibber seems to work just fine.
